Not all the blood vessels are rigid in nature.

Blood vessels like arteriosclerotic is a good example of the rigid blood vessels

Arteriosclerosis occurs at the old age results in the loss of elasticity in the blood vessels because of the thickening and hardening of the walls in the arteries.
